Common in Pasco County

Pasco County has absorbed a lot of the growth pushing north out of Tampa, which means demolition here is often the first stage of a larger site development rather than a standalone job. Land clearing and structure removal on acreage are as common as building demolition, and properties frequently carry outbuildings, old barns or agricultural structures that came with the land.

  • Land clearing on acreage ahead of development
  • Barn, shed and outbuilding removal
  • Residential demolition on larger rural lots
  • Debris hauling after clearing or storm damage

Do I need a permit to demolish a structure in Zephyrhills?

Almost always, and permits are handled as part of the job. What is needed early is the property address and the owner's details, since the application is built from those. Requirements are set by the Pasco County authority or the municipality, depending on where the property sits.
